Shuttle Bus from Castle Cary
Started by pukkaone, Jun 19 2010 07:16 PM
5 replies to this topic#1
Posted 19 June 2010 - 07:16 PM
I'll be getting into Castle Cary station at about 7:30am on Wednesday, and was wondering if anyone knew how long I'd be likely to be waiting for the first shuttle bus?

No, I wouldn't advise walking- it's quite a hefty hike to do laden with your rucksack and tent (though I must admit I have pondered this in the past, also being very impatient myself!) Once you're on the bus, keep watch out the window and you'll see the foolishness of the proposal by the time you arrive on site!
It's very difficult to predict how busy things will be this year as they are allowing cars in the car parks on the Tuesday night for the first time. Hopefully this will reduce the traffic on the roads on the Wednesday morning, reducing shuttle bus waiting and journey times. However with the football being on early afternoon a lot of people think there will be a rush of folk going down the wednesday morning so they can set up tents in time for the match.
I've been getting the shuttle bus from castle cary since 2003, and most years it's been quick and fine (usually about 30 minutes wait) some years there hasn't even been any queing up. Last year was hopefully a one off- it took about 2 hours of waiting due to the roads all being congested. Like I said, hopefully the Tuesday car park opening idea will put a stop to that.
In answer to your original question- I'm not sure how long you'll have to wait for a shuttle bus if you arrive at 7.30am. Usually they have buses awaiting each train arrival, however as the gates for the festival don't actually open to let people in until... erm 8.30am this year I think, they might not pick you up until nearer that time (I could be wrong though, I've never arrived that early- but even if they do pick you up straight away you'll still have to queue at the festival gate until opening time)
I think you may be looking at a wait of 30 mins to an hour- if there are no problems with the roads. Bus journey time is just under 30 mins if the roads are clear, so hopefully you'll be on site pretty soon after opening time (unless there is a repeat of the traffic hell of last year, but even then the waits weren't too bad that early in the morning)
KaleidoscopeEyes- Buses should be fine on Thursday, as I think most people will have arrived on the wednesday, as they seemed to last year. that should mean that the roads are less busy and there's fewer folk to cram onto the shuttle buses- hopefully it should be a quick and straightforward jaunt! Though I'd recommend you try to get there on the Wednesday if you can, just so you get an extra day to explore.
